SHREWSBURY, Mass -- The Buccaneers men's rowing team competed at the Head of the Snake Regatta on ae Quinsigamond in Shrewsbury. Competing in two different men's events, the Bucs finished second and seventh in the Novice 8's race and 14th and 23rd in the Collegiate 8's event.

In the Novic 8's race, the Buccaneers A shell finished in second place behind UMass Amherst with a time of 16:55.115. The Bucs B boat came in seventh place behind UMass' B boat with a final time of 23:47.743. The A boat beat out WPI by 13 seconds to take home the silver in the race.

The Bucs A boat in the Collegiate 8's race finished in 14th place, one second behind Middlebury with a time of 15:13.616. They were less than three second behind URI's A boat. The Bucs B boat finished in 23rd in the field of 24 boats beating out Boston College's C shell by 10 seconds.
